Services for Myrna Hufford, of Morris, Minnesota, will be held on Friday, May 30, 2025, at 10:30 a.m. at Good Shepherd Lutheran Church in Morris with Reverend Michael Hanson officiating. Visitation will be on Thursday from 4-6:00 p.m. at the Pedersen Funeral Home in Morris and will continue one hour prior to the services at the church on Friday. Burial will be at Summit Cemetery in Morris.
Myrna Ann Miller, was born on November 11, 1937, to Carl and Helen (Belding) at her family home near Herman in Macsville, Township, Minnesota. She was baptized and confirmed at Bethlehem Lutheran Church and graduated from Herman High School in 1955. After her schooling, she worked for the Herman Market Co. for five years. On July 1, 1961, Myrna married Dick Hufford at Bethlehem Lutheran Church in Herman. To this union, three sons were born; two remain on the family farm and one is in Kansas.
Myrna enjoyed farming with Dick and the boys – from picking rock to helping with the cattle – she did it all! Myrna was a member of the Merry Homemaker’s Club for many years, was on a bowling league, and enjoyed a night out with the girls. She was a charter member at Good Shepherd Church, LCMC, and was active in bible study, decorating for church functions and serving at coffee hour. Myrna enjoyed traveling – including: up north for fishing trips, bus trips to Arizona, California, Florida, Hawaii, and also going to Arizona in the winters to visit John and the girls.
Myrna loved her God, Dick, her three boys, her grandchildren, and her great-grandchildren.
Myrna died peacefully on Sunday, May 25, 2025, at the Courage Cottage in Morris, she was 87 years old.
Myrna is survived by her three sons: Jeff Hufford of Morris, Kirby (Julie) Hufford of Morris and John (Brenda) Hufford of Wichita, KS; seven grandchildren: Mitchell (Katie) Hufford of Morris, Taylor (Amanda) Hufford of Morris, Makenna Hufford (Fiancé, Jake Swalla) of Morris, Brianna Hufford of Scottsdale, AZ, Heather Hufford of Scottsdale, AZ, Brooke Hufford of Phoenix, AZ, and Emma Friesen of Morris; three great-grandchildren: Easton Hufford, Carson Hufford and Brooks Hufford; sister, Kitty (Pete) Haug of Fargo, ND; brother-in-law: Jim (Peggy) Hufford of Maple Grove; and several nieces and nephews and extended family and friends. She was preceded in death by her parents; her husband, Dickie in 2024; one infant grandchild, Jordan Hufford; sister, Virene and her husband, Buck Dilly; sister-in-law, Sandy Hufford.
